A former Allentown police officer and one-time city councilman will serve 90 days of probation after pleading guilty Wednesday to harassing his former girlfriend. A jury was seated for Antonio “Tony” Phillips’ trial in Lehigh County Court when he agreed to plead guilty to a summary count of harassment…
